Abstract Translation:
BABIS, Muslim sectarians who have just appeared in Persia. We read in a letter from Tabriz, dated 1 March 1849:
“We have been talking for some time about a religious sect which has taken up arms in Mazandaran to defend the teachings of its leader, who is currently in prison here. The Babis, as they are called after their leader, profess very advanced socialist ideas; they are as mad as one can imagine, and they have already gone to excess against the authorities. Now that the government seems completely free from the embarrassments of Khurasan, it will probably be able to reduce them.” We do not have, so far, other details on the Babis.
